The Department of Transport in Abu Dhabi has announced the partial opening of the Baynoona Tunnel in the Al Bateen area, which is part of a comprehensive plan to improve the road network in the capital. The project aims to facilitate traffic movement and reduce congestion in the area, reflecting the government's commitment to infrastructure development.
The new tunnel represents a significant step towards improving mobility in the Al Bateen area, being one of the vital projects that have been planned for a long time. The tunnel has been designed to meet the needs of increasing traffic, contributing to enhanced road safety.
Event Details
The Baynoona Tunnel extends over several kilometers, and the project also includes improvements to the surrounding roads. The works have been carried out in collaboration with a group of local and international companies, reflecting the effective partnership between the public and private sectors.
This opening comes at a time when the capital, Abu Dhabi, is experiencing increasing population growth, necessitating continuous improvements in transportation infrastructure. The project has been carefully planned to ensure it meets the needs of citizens and residents.
